7+ Best BOD: How to Calculate Biological Oxygen Demand?

The determination of the amount of oxygen required by microorganisms to decompose organic matter in a water sample is a crucial step in assessing water quality. This process involves measuring the dissolved oxygen content of a sample immediately, incubating a sealed sample at a specific temperature (typically 20C) for a set period (usually 5 days), and then measuring the dissolved oxygen again. The difference between the initial and final dissolved oxygen levels provides an indication of the biodegradable organic material present. For example, if a water sample initially contains 8 mg/L of dissolved oxygen, and after 5 days it contains 3 mg/L, then the calculated oxygen demand is 5 mg/L.

This evaluation is vital for monitoring the health of aquatic ecosystems and ensuring the effectiveness of wastewater treatment processes. Elevated levels indicate a higher concentration of organic pollutants, which can deplete oxygen levels in natural waters, harming aquatic life. Historically, the method has been a cornerstone of environmental monitoring, providing essential data for regulations and pollution control efforts, contributing to the maintenance of healthy water resources and protecting public health.

Easy Gas Piping Size Calculator Online + Charts

A tool employed to determine the appropriate diameter of pipes used in the delivery of gaseous fuels is a computational aid. This instrument utilizes factors such as gas type, appliance consumption rates (measured in BTU/hr or cubic feet per hour), pipe length, and allowable pressure drop to compute the minimum required pipe size. The result ensures sufficient gas flow to all appliances connected to the system. For example, a residence requiring natural gas for a furnace, water heater, and stove would necessitate an appropriately sized distribution network to guarantee adequate operation of all devices simultaneously.

Properly dimensioned gas conveyance infrastructure is essential for safety and optimal appliance performance. Undersized conduits can lead to inadequate fuel supply, resulting in appliance malfunction, inefficiency, or even hazardous conditions such as carbon monoxide production. Historically, sizing was a manual, complex process prone to error. The advent of these tools streamlines this procedure, reducing the likelihood of miscalculations and promoting safe and reliable gas distribution systems. This technological advancement allows for quicker and more precise installations, adhering to code requirements and ensuring homeowner well-being.

6+ Calculate Diminished Car Value: Easy Guide & Tips

The process of quantifying the reduction in a vehicle’s market worth following an accident, even after repairs have been completed, necessitates a careful evaluation. This loss in value, resulting from the perception that the vehicle is now less desirable due to its accident history, can be estimated through various methods. For instance, if a vehicle was worth $20,000 before an accident and is now valued at $17,000 after repairs, the reduction amounts to $3,000. The challenge lies in accurately determining this specific figure, considering numerous factors that impact the final calculation.

Accurately assessing this devaluation is vital for several reasons. Vehicle owners may seek compensation from the at-fault party’s insurance company to recover this loss. Furthermore, understanding this financial impact allows for more informed decisions when selling or trading in the vehicle. Documenting and pursuing a claim based on this reduction in market value can significantly offset the financial burden resulting from an accident. The concept of recouping this lost value has gained traction over time, becoming a recognized right for vehicle owners in many jurisdictions.

Free App Advertising Revenue Calculator | Estimate ROI

This tool provides a means of estimating the income a mobile application can generate through advertisements. It usually takes into account factors like the app’s user base, average user engagement, ad formats utilized (e.g., banner, interstitial, rewarded video), and the prevailing eCPM (effective cost per mille, or cost per thousand impressions) within the relevant app category and geographic region. For instance, an app with a large, actively engaged user base in a high-value market could potentially realize a significantly higher revenue forecast than an app with limited users in a less lucrative region, even using the same ad formats.

The utilization of such a forecasting mechanism is vital for app developers and publishers for several reasons. It aids in informed decision-making regarding monetization strategies, investment allocations, and business planning. By projecting potential ad earnings, developers can assess the viability of their app, justify development costs, attract investors, and optimize ad placement for maximum yield. Historically, the process of estimating ad revenue relied heavily on guesswork and rudimentary calculations. The advent of these instruments enables more data-driven and realistic projections, reducing risk and enhancing the potential for financial success.

Easy Dosage Calc: Calculate Dosage by Weight

The determination of medication amount based on an individual’s mass is a fundamental practice in various fields, including medicine, veterinary science, and pharmacology. This method ensures that the administered quantity is appropriate for the recipient’s physiology, maximizing therapeutic effects while minimizing the risk of adverse reactions. For example, a pediatrician might prescribe amoxicillin at a dosage of 20mg per kilogram of a child’s body weight to treat an ear infection.

Using body mass to establish correct medication amounts has significant benefits. It allows for personalized treatment plans, recognizing that individuals of different sizes metabolize drugs differently. This approach is particularly crucial in pediatrics and geriatrics, where variations in body composition and organ function can significantly impact drug pharmacokinetics. Historically, reliance on standard dosages led to both under-treatment and over-treatment, highlighting the need for weight-based calculations to improve patient outcomes.
